Overview
The HengaoDe HAD-NTS-4810C/II Smart Universal Vacuum Gauge Controller is an engineered solution for precise, real-time vacuum monitoring and control in laboratory, pilot-scale, and industrial vacuum systems. It functions as a multi-gauge interface unit—supporting both thermocouple (TC) and cold-cathode ionization/composite gauges—operating on fundamental physical principles: thermal conductivity measurement for low-to-mid vacuum (0.1–5×10³ Pa), and electron emission–induced ion current detection for high vacuum (1×10⁻⁴–1×10⁵ Pa). Unlike legacy analog controllers, the HAD-NTS-4810C/II integrates digital signal conditioning, adaptive current regulation, and intelligent gauge auto-identification to eliminate manual configuration errors and reduce calibration drift. Its architecture complies with IEC 61000-4 electromagnetic immunity standards and supports stable operation under variable load conditions typical of diffusion pump, turbomolecular pump, and dry scroll vacuum systems.

Software & Data Management
The controller operates autonomously without host PC dependency, but offers optional USB-C and RS485 interfaces for integration into SCADA or LIMS platforms. Internal firmware supports CSV export of timestamped pressure logs directly to removable microSD card (not included). All logged data include embedded metadata: gauge ID, measurement mode, unit selection, ambient temperature (via internal sensor), and battery voltage—enabling traceability per ISO/IEC 17025 clause 7.7. The embedded GUI allows full parameter configuration—including alarm thresholds (high/low pressure limits), backlight timeout, and auto-shutdown delay—without external software. Firmware updates are performed via signed binary upload through the touchscreen interface, ensuring version control integrity.

FAQ
Does the HAD-NTS-4810C/II require external calibration after installation?
No—each gauge retains its individual calibration coefficients; the controller applies stored correction factors automatically upon gauge identification. However, periodic system-level verification using a NIST-traceable reference standard (e.g., MKS 925 Baratron) is recommended every 12 months per ISO/IEC 17025.
Can the device operate while charging?
Yes—DC 12.6 V input enables uninterrupted operation during battery recharge, with automatic switchover between battery and adapter power sources.
Is firmware upgrade capability available in the base model?
Yes—firmware updates are delivered as encrypted .bin files via USB-C or microSD and installed through the Settings > System Update menu.
What is the maximum cable length supported for remote gauge connection?
For thermocouple gauges: up to 30 m using shielded twisted-pair (STP) cable with 100 Ω characteristic impedance. For ionization gauges: ≤15 m recommended to maintain signal integrity and minimize noise coupling.
